Homologous Proteins Examples . Homology modeling is a method for building protein 3d structures using protein primary sequence and utilizing prior knowledge gained. Homology modeling, also known as comparative modeling, is a method used to predict the 3d structure of a protein with an unknown structure by using the known structure of a homologous protein. A homologous trait is often called a homolog (also spelled homologue). Paralogs are homologous genes that are the result of a duplication event. Orthologs are homologous genes that are the result of a speciation event. Homologous protein sequences are those with a common evolutionary origin.
